Grammar

Incorrect use of the definite article

× I definitely love buying the shoes

I definitely love buying shoes

In English, when talking about things in general, we usually do not use 'the' before plural nouns. 'The shoes' refers to specific shoes, but here the student means shoes in general.

Incorrect use of adjectives or adverbs

× although I'm a little bit taller, my height is 170

although I'm a little tall, my height is 170

The phrase 'a little bit taller' is comparative and requires a comparison object, which is missing. 'A little tall' is more appropriate to express a slight degree of height without comparison.

Incorrect use of the definite article

× I prefer buying the shoes or everything online

I prefer buying shoes or everything online

When speaking generally about shoes, the definite article 'the' is not used before plural nouns.

Subject-verb agreement errors

× because the shops is heavily crowded

because the shops are heavily crowded

The subject 'shops' is plural, so the verb should be 'are' instead of 'is' to agree in number.
